WebIan Buchanan. Containers and virtual machines are very similar resource virtualization technologies. Virtualization is the process in which a system singular resource like RAM, CPU, Disk, or Networking can be ‘virtualized’ and represented as multiple resources. Naturally, the global container fleet has … Web19 de abr. de 2024 · Different from demurrage and detention, which come as a result of using equipment for longer than the allowed free time, storage fees are incurred from using the facilities. Think of demurrage and detention/per diem as the fee for “rental” of the equipment, whereas storage refers to the use of the physical space. Made from durable, BPA-free plastic, these containers come with locking, leakproof … Web11 de mar. de 2024 · When you specify a Pod, you can optionally specify how much of each resource a container needs. The most common resources to specify are CPU and memory (RAM); there are others. When you specify the resource request for containers in a Pod, the kube-scheduler uses this information to decide which node to place the Pod on. …

Web10 de nov. de 2024 · Using date command. The easiest way to change the time in a Docker container is to change the time using ‘date’ command after connecting to the container. docker exec -it container-name /bin/bash date +%T -s "10:00:00". The typical organization that uses a container orchestrator runs 11.5 containers per host, as compared to about 6.5 containers per host in unorchestrated environments.
